Is it possible to create a link between two work books?

I have prepared a data base workbook with client contact information in
one row and a work book with the clients activities. I would like to
click on a cell (A1) (like a button) at the begining of each client in
the data base that would link me to the client's activity workbook.

EXAMPLE:
DATA BASE WORK BOOK
A1 A2
LINK JOHN DOE

CLICK ON A1(LINK) TAKES YOU TO A CELL IN ACTIVITY WORKBOOK.

Ideas appreciated.

You could even use a worksheet formula:

=HYPERLINK("C:\my documents\excel\book1.xls#'sheet 1'!A1")
